The last thing sw related is at 8pm, hyperspace hoopla you can look for videos online. Other than that just the sw store.
 
We saw folks sitting on the front row for Hoopla by around 3:00. By 6:30, we could only get last row, in front of the sound booth. I watched it with my 61 pound DD11 on my back.......ouch. Wish they'd move it to the Indy theater.

You need to get there at least 2 to 3 hours before the show. When I used to do front row for Hoopla, I'd get there at least for the end of the last Padawan mind challenge. I waited until the end of Obi-Wan And Beyond this year, and a front row position was not possible at that time (about 7). There is a post above that says people are starting to "camp out" for the Hoopla at 3 PM which is 5 hours before the show.

One thing you need to watch out for is one or two people holding a place for a larger party. You may find what you think is a good position and then get squeezed out of it.

They will cancel the show if water pools on the stage. At that point it is dangerous for the performers. May also be the case that some of the costumes won't hold up in rain.

Agreed. DH got front and center at 4:30 pm on a Saturday evening. That is consistent with when we saw people lining up last year too. Watch the last PMC from near the front (he let people with kids in the show ahead of him to watch them then moved up). It was a long wait but he was very happy.
